amvcp-tables-sort-virt

Community

Sort and virtualize huge tables with CSV export.

AuthorEmasoft
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ill helps you make large HTML tables feel fast and reliable by adding stable sorting, big-data virtualization, frozen columns for context, and standards-compliant CSV export.

Core Features & Use Cases

  • 3-state sortable tables with stable behavior: Implements a none → asc → desc cycle with single-active-column rule, numeric detection, and natural string ordering.
  • Big-data virtualization (window-scroll): Renders only the visible row window while keeping the page scrollbar accurate, using measured row height (median of sample).
  • Frozen sticky columns: Keeps the first N columns visible during horizontal scroll using sticky positioning and correct layering.
  • CSV export (RFC-4180, clipboard only): Exports full table data as CSV with correct quoting, spanning-cell handling, CRLF line endings, and a copy-to-clipboard UI.

Quick Start

Use amvcp-tables-sort-virt when building a report with a sortable table that may contain 1000+ rows and needs frozen identifier columns plus CSV export for spreadsheet workflows.

Dependency Matrix

Required Modules

None required

Components

references

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: amvcp-tables-sort-virt
Download link: https://github.com/Emasoft/ai-maestro-visual-communicator-plugin/archive/main.zip#amvcp-tables-sort-virt

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.